What Does a a Pet Insurance Agent in Burlington Cost?
In Massachusetts, pet insurance premiums typically range from $20 to $60 per month for dogs and $15 to $40 per month for cats, depending on the pet age, breed, and coverage level. Annual deductibles often range from $100 to $500, with reimbursement rates of 70% to 90%. Costs vary by case and policy details. This is general information, not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does a pet insurance agent in Burlington do?
A pet insurance agent helps you compare and purchase policies from different insurance companies. They explain coverage limits, deductibles, and reimbursement rates. Agents in Burlington are licensed by the Massachusetts Division of Insurance.
Is pet insurance required in Massachusetts?
No, Massachusetts does not require pet insurance by law. However, some landlords or boarding facilities may ask for proof of coverage. An agent can help you find a policy that meets those requirements.
Can a pet insurance agent help with pre-existing conditions?
Most pet insurance policies exclude pre-existing conditions. An agent can explain which conditions are not covered and suggest plans with shorter waiting periods. They cannot change the insurance company rules regarding pre-existing conditions.
